Edwin Lutyens' Styled Home

Our clients, having enjoyed modern houses for several years, were eager to infuse their new home with unique character while still embracing modern simplicity. Their vision was clear: "Our main aim is to create something traditional but at the same time take advantage of some more modern and simple lines."

To achieve this, we incorporated a variety of natural materials that enhance both the aesthetic and functional qualities of the home. These materials include cobbles, handmade roof tiles, lime render, and timber flooring, each chosen for their authenticity and timeless appeal. The design emphasises a seamless integration of traditional elements with contemporary design, striking a perfect balance between the old and the new.

One of the standout features of the house is the creative use of level changes. By extending the windows from the basement to the ground floor, we highlighted these transitions and allowed natural light to flow throughout the home.

This Arts and Crafts style home prioritises taste and style over mere glamour. As you explore the property, each corner offers a fresh and intriguing perspective, showcasing thoughtful design and craftsmanship.

This blend of traditional charm and modern simplicity creates a unique and inviting living space, reflecting our clients' desire for a home with true character and individuality.
